From 143ab20a10fb43f43dc21ed89d63cd9ba004abe3 Mon Sep 17 00:00:00 2001
From: "m.mansour" <m.mansour@mmansour.aditosoftware.local>
Date: Fri, 19 Jul 2019 17:47:53 +0200
Subject: [PATCH] adjusted xml files, made unique create_salesorder and a
 folder for salesorders

---
 .../{ => Salesorder}/create_dunninglevel_keyword.xml   |  0
 .../{ => Salesorder}/create_ordertype_keyword.xml      |  0
 .../2019.1.4/{ => Salesorder}/update_Salesorder.xml    | 10 ++++++++--
 .liquibase/Data_alias/basic/2019.1.4/changelog.xml     |  6 +++---
 .../Data_alias/basic/init/struct/create_salesorder.xml |  9 +--------
 neonView/OrderEdit_view/OrderEdit_view.aod             |  4 ++++
 6 files changed, 16 insertions(+), 13 deletions(-)
 rename .liquibase/Data_alias/basic/2019.1.4/{ => Salesorder}/create_dunninglevel_keyword.xml (100%)
 rename .liquibase/Data_alias/basic/2019.1.4/{ => Salesorder}/create_ordertype_keyword.xml (100%)
 rename .liquibase/Data_alias/basic/2019.1.4/{ => Salesorder}/update_Salesorder.xml (72%)

diff --git a/.liquibase/Data_alias/basic/2019.1.4/create_dunninglevel_keyword.xml b/.liquibase/Data_alias/basic/2019.1.4/Salesorder/create_dunninglevel_keyword.xml
similarity index 100%
rename from .liquibase/Data_alias/basic/2019.1.4/create_dunninglevel_keyword.xml
rename to .liquibase/Data_alias/basic/2019.1.4/Salesorder/create_dunninglevel_keyword.xml
diff --git a/.liquibase/Data_alias/basic/2019.1.4/create_ordertype_keyword.xml b/.liquibase/Data_alias/basic/2019.1.4/Salesorder/create_ordertype_keyword.xml
similarity index 100%
rename from .liquibase/Data_alias/basic/2019.1.4/create_ordertype_keyword.xml
rename to .liquibase/Data_alias/basic/2019.1.4/Salesorder/create_ordertype_keyword.xml
diff --git a/.liquibase/Data_alias/basic/2019.1.4/update_Salesorder.xml b/.liquibase/Data_alias/basic/2019.1.4/Salesorder/update_Salesorder.xml
similarity index 72%
rename from .liquibase/Data_alias/basic/2019.1.4/update_Salesorder.xml
rename to .liquibase/Data_alias/basic/2019.1.4/Salesorder/update_Salesorder.xml
index 0a03c722c22..0b09845c434 100644
--- a/.liquibase/Data_alias/basic/2019.1.4/update_Salesorder.xml
+++ b/.liquibase/Data_alias/basic/2019.1.4/Salesorder/update_Salesorder.xml
@@ -3,8 +3,14 @@
     <changeSet author="m.mansour" id="a48f9e54-16ac-4bb8-8f2a-395f3035c55e">  
         
         <addColumn tableName="SALESORDER">
-            <column name="OBJECT_TYPE" type="NVARCHAR(63)">
-            </column>
+            <column name="OBJECT_TYPE" type="NVARCHAR(63)"/>
+            <column name="CANCELLATION " type="TINYINT"/>
+            <column name="UNPAID" type="INTEGER"/>
+            <column name="PAID" type="INTEGER"/>
+            <column name="PAYDUEDATE" type="DATETIME"/>
+            <column name="PAYDATE" type="DATETIME"/>
+            <column name="DUNNINGDATE" type="DATETIME"/>
+            <column name="DUNNINGLEVEL" type="CHAR(36)"/>
         </addColumn>
         <renameColumn newColumnName="OBJECT_ROWID" oldColumnName="SALESPROJECT_ID" tableName="SALESORDER" columnDataType="CHAR(36)"/>
         <update tableName="SALESORDER">
diff --git a/.liquibase/Data_alias/basic/2019.1.4/changelog.xml b/.liquibase/Data_alias/basic/2019.1.4/changelog.xml
index b1975265893..7599179a434 100644
--- a/.liquibase/Data_alias/basic/2019.1.4/changelog.xml
+++ b/.liquibase/Data_alias/basic/2019.1.4/changelog.xml
@@ -184,7 +184,7 @@
     <include relativeToChangelogFile="true" file="AditoBasic/init_NotificationPriority.xml"/>
     <include relativeToChangelogFile="true" file="AditoBasic/init_NotificationState.xml"/>
     
-    <include relativeToChangelogFile="true" file="create_ordertype_keyword.xml"/>
-    <include relativeToChangelogFile="true" file="create_dunninglevel_keyword.xml"/>
-    <include relativeToChangelogFile="true" file="update_Salesorder.xml"/>
+    <include relativeToChangelogFile="true" file="Salesorder/create_ordertype_keyword.xml"/>
+    <include relativeToChangelogFile="true" file="Salesorder/create_dunninglevel_keyword.xml"/>
+    <include relativeToChangelogFile="true" file="Salesorder/update_Salesorder.xml"/>
 </databaseChangeLog>
diff --git a/.liquibase/Data_alias/basic/init/struct/create_salesorder.xml b/.liquibase/Data_alias/basic/init/struct/create_salesorder.xml
index b99f8dd61bd..9825fe170a5 100644
--- a/.liquibase/Data_alias/basic/init/struct/create_salesorder.xml
+++ b/.liquibase/Data_alias/basic/init/struct/create_salesorder.xml
@@ -1,6 +1,6 @@
 <?xml version="1.1" encoding="UTF-8" standalone="no"?>
 <databaseChangeLog xmlns="http://www.liquibase.org/xml/ns/dbchangelog" xmlns:ext="http://www.liquibase.org/xml/ns/dbchangelog-ext"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://www.liquibase.org/xml/ns/dbchangelog-ext http://www.liquibase.org/xml/ns/dbchangelog/dbchangelog-ext.xsd http://www.liquibase.org/xml/ns/dbchangelog http://www.liquibase.org/xml/ns/dbchangelog/dbchangelog-3.6.xsd">
-<changeSet author="m.mansour" id="c2f89ee9-0c4c-4961-935a-b399381c720d">
+<changeSet author="j.hoermann" id="c8469998-9763-4300-87af-925af8c8ea5a">
 	<createTable tableName="SALESORDER">
 		<column name="SALESORDERID" type="CHAR(36)">
                     <constraints primaryKey="true" primaryKeyName="PK_SALESORDER_SALESORDERID"/>
@@ -12,13 +12,6 @@
 		<column name="SALESORDER_ID" type="CHAR(36)"/>
                 <column name="ORDERTYPE" type="CHAR(36)"/>
                 <column name="ORDERSTATUS" type="TINYINT"/>
-                <column name="CANCELLATION " type="TINYINT"/>
-                <column name="UNPAID" type="INTEGER"/>
-                <column name="PAID" type="INTEGER"/>
-                <column name="PAYDUEDATE" type="DATETIME"/>
-                <column name="PAYDATE" type="DATETIME"/>
-                <column name="DUNNINGDATE" type="DATETIME"/>
-                <column name="DUNNINGLEVEL" type="CHAR(36)"/>
                 <column name="HEADER" type="NCLOB"/>
                 <column name="FOOTER" type="NCLOB"/>
                 <column name="SALESORDERDATE" type="DATETIME"/>
diff --git a/neonView/OrderEdit_view/OrderEdit_view.aod b/neonView/OrderEdit_view/OrderEdit_view.aod
index d4dd5fbc34d..f066e7be58f 100644
--- a/neonView/OrderEdit_view/OrderEdit_view.aod
+++ b/neonView/OrderEdit_view/OrderEdit_view.aod
@@ -60,6 +60,10 @@
           <name>c4b3c8ed-4625-4785-abc6-c726171ff7f4</name>
           <entityField>FOOTER</entityField>
         </entityFieldLink>
+        <entityFieldLink>
+          <name>97eca233-7383-4fb6-97ff-d722e422befa</name>
+          <entityField>SALESORDERDATE</entityField>
+        </entityFieldLink>
         <entityFieldLink>
           <name>31ed9eba-66a1-4114-a1fe-61ef475d532d</name>
           <entityField>PAID</entityField>
-- 
GitLab